摘  要:煤层冲刷带是一种常见的矿井地质现象,井下采掘作业进入冲刷带区域时往往会导致工作面瓦斯涌出异常。以新集二矿综采工作面过煤层冲刷带开采为例,分析了煤层冲刷带对工作面瓦斯涌出的影响。根据工作面过冲刷带区域出现瓦斯超限的原因,制定了施工砂岩裂隙瓦斯探查钻孔、顺层钻孔、穿层钻孔、短孔注水等针对性的瓦斯防治补充措施,最终实现了工作面的安全回采,为类似条件下的工作面瓦斯防治提供了借鉴。Coal seam scouring zone is a common geological phenomenon in coal mines. When the underground mining operation enters the scouring zone, it often leads to abnormal gas emission in the working face. Taking fully mechanized mining face of Xinji No.2 coal mine passing through coal seam scouring zone as an example, the influences of coal seam scouring zone on mining face are analyzed.According to the reasons of gas concentration overrun, targeted gas control technologies such as sandstone fracture gas exploration borehole, coal seam borehole, crossing hole,short borehole water injection, etc. are developed, and safe production of the mining face is realized. The practice provides reference for gas control of mining face with similar condition.
